Schneider Electric is looking for a Service Project Manager for the Las Vegas, NV areaResponsibilities Include:- Day-to-Day Management:
Oversee daily onsite activities, including service projects, service quotes, and time-and-material work orders, as well as on-demand service resource allocation. - Project Participation:
Participate in walkdowns as required for projects in collaboration with Schneider Electric sales and designated Site Security staff. - Ongoing Project Involvement:
Stay actively engaged in ongoing service projects to ensure successful implementation, which includes:
- Attending weekly project review meetings.
- Facilitating requests for network IP coordination and resource allocation.
- Regularly communicating with key stakeholders to provide status updates and ensure prompt closure of associated work orders/projects.
- Project Management:
Manage all associated tasks related to service projects. Responsibilities include:
- Documenting projects (RFIs, meeting minutes, punch lists, transmittal logs, submittal logs, change order logs, and issues logs).
- Preparing project revenue forecasts, schedules of values, and billings.
- Maximizing gross margin improvement on all projects by leveraging labor efficiencies, outsourcing, and purchasing strategies to reduce costs.
- Preparing and updating project schedules and budgets.
- Coordinating all change order reviews and pricing activities, including estimating and proposal creation.
- Service Agreement Oversight:
Work with the Service Delivery Manager (SDM) to schedule tasks and manage hours associated with tasks outlined in Service Agreements (SAs). - Site Inventory Control:
Collaborate with the Schneider Electric Warehouse for deliveries and material handling. - Technical Assistance:
Provide technical support and participate in basic field startup processes, including commissioning of simple control systems to ensure proper operation on small service projects. - Quality Control Inspections:
Perform quality control inspections on all service projects. - Safety Compliance:
Ensure the team aligns with customer safety protocols and site requirements.
Qualifications:• This position is typically held by an individual that has at least 5+ years' combined experience as
a BMS or Security Service Technician, Project Engineer or PM with equivalent industry
experience
• Project managers must have construction industry knowledge, strong communication skills,
strong understanding of contracting procedures and experience with responsibilities such as
project correspondence, documentation, timely notice of changes and claims, negotiation and
subcontract and vendor management. Are organized, proactive, and can effectively communicate
with customers as well as internal resources
• This individual should have significant industry knowledge and an advanced understanding of
BMS Systems (Hardware, Software and Networking).
• This position will require the individual to be technical and may include commissioning and start up of simple projects
• The Project Manager works under minimal supervision and reports to the Service Operations
Manager
